Email Forwarding

With Email Forwarding, we pass the details of your inbound SMS to you and your staff via email so that you are informed of new SMS without having to check your SMS Inbox.

BusinessLink, for example, put together an above-the-line marketing campaign encouraging people to request a call-back by texting TTS to a shared inbound number. They chose Email Forwarding as a means of real-time notification so that they could respond as quickly as possible to any call-back requests.

Furthermore, by combining Email Forwarding with Email-to-SMS, you can have an email-based 'out of the box' 2-way SMS solution.

SMS API

Using our HTTP API, SMTP API and/or SMPP Interface, your inbound SMS can be forwarded to your own remote applications in real-time. And, because the SMS gets handed over to you, handling is limited to your imagination, with examples including:

Static Response

Although use of our APIs allow you to send back dynamic replies, we also provide you with the ability to provide pre-written replies which can be sent back immediately upon receipt of inbound SMS.

Although they can be used to provide canned responses in multiple choice SMS quizzes, they are most often used to provide acknowledgements as a best practice - so that mobile users are not left in doubt as to whether their messages have been received or not.
